About this quote
Have you ever looked back at a year, a month, or even a decade, and wondered where it all went? In this profound reflection, Carlos Ruiz Zafón reminds us that time is not merely measured by the ticking of a clock, but by the weight of our experiences, passions, and connections. When our days are filled with routine, distraction, and a lack of purpose, time slips through our fingers like dust, speeding past us in a blur of empty moments. Life isn't meant to be merely endured or watched from a platform as it rushes by; it is meant to be lived deeply and intentionally. This poignant life advice serves as a gentle wakeup call to examine how we spend our precious days. Every morning offers a new opportunity to step onto the tracks and make our lives matter, whether through creative pursuits, acts of kindness, or simply being fully present for the people we love. By infusing meaning into our everyday routines, we slow down the relentless march of time, transforming fleeting moments into unforgettable memories. Don't let your days become trains that pass you by—make your station a destination where life truly stops and stays awhile.
